River Country Co-op is seeking a highly skilled Commodities Manager in Owen, WI to oversee the strategic sourcing, procurement, and management of key commodities critical to our business operations. The ideal candidate will bring strong analytical skills, market insight, and supplier relationship expertise to optimize cost, ensure supply stability, and support organizational growth.

Key Responsibilities

  • Develop and implement commodity strategies to support cost efficiency, quality, and supply continuity.
  • Monitor global market trends, pricing, supply risks, and economic indicators impacting assigned commodities.
  • Negotiate with suppliers to secure contracts, and manage long-term supply agreements.
  • Work with our direct ship customers and manage the relationship with those customers.
  • Collaborate cross-functionally with Operations and Logistics to forecast demand and align purchasing strategy with business needs.
  • Identify cost-saving opportunities through strategic sourcing, alternative suppliers, and improved processes.
  • Analyze data to provide accurate pricing forecasts, budget inputs, and cost models.
  • Mitigate risks in the supply chain through proactive planning, contracting, oversight of commodity DPR and contingency strategies.
  • Ensure compliance with internal policies and external regulations.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ain Management, Business, Economics, or a related field is preferred or 3 years of experience.
  • Strong negotiation and contract management skills.
  • Proven ability to analyze market data, economic trends, and pricing structures.
  • Excellent communication, relationship-building, problem-solving abilities and ability to pass on market information to our customers.
  • Proficiency in data analysis tools and Microsoft Office.

Preferred Skills

  • Experience with agriculture commodities.
  • Excellent customer communication.
  • Hedging and managing commodity position.
